verb
- to cause or reduce to a state of cretinism; to stunt the physical or mental development of a person, especially through iodine deficiency or other medical causes
- to make or treat someone as if they were a cretin; to degrade or demean intellectually
Usage: medical/technical; third-person singular present tense of 'cretinize'
Usage: offensive; dated; derogatory
